Buy Biogas Activated Carbon

Activated carbon is a necessary step in biogas purification, primarily to remove problematic contaminants. It has the ability to adsorb hydrogen sulfide (H₂S), which is a corrosive, poisonous gas, and several different siloxanes that produce damaging deposits upon combustion, both of which are critical to remove during the purification process. The crucial function of activated carbon depends on its large surface area for physical adsorption. There are also forms of activated carbon that are chemically impregnated and these conditions allow H₂S to be catalytically converted to inert products.
 
Activated carbon is employed in filter beds that treat corrosive raw biogas as it flows through the activated carbon by-products and exits the carbon filtration. Activated carbon not only removes potentially harmful H₂S and siloxanes, protecting downstream equipment (like engines), and allowing the use of fuel or injected biogas into the electrical grid; it also assists in the overall purification of biogas, and presents an added level of operational safety in biogas purification.

Processus et technologie

1. Hydrogen Sulfide (H₂S) Removal

Aperçu de la solution

Chemically impregnated activated carbon catalytically converts toxic H₂S into harmless elemental sulfur through oxidation. Installed in fixed-bed filters where raw biogas flows through the carbon media.

2. Siloxane Removal

Aperçu de la solution

High-surface-area activated carbon physically adsorbs siloxane compounds through its microporous structure. Implemented in adsorption towers upstream of combustion equipment.

3.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s) and Odor Control

Aperçu de la solution

Activated carbon traps diverse organic compounds and odor-causing substances via physical adsorption. Used in final polishing stages before biogas utilization.

4. Carbon Dioxide (CO₂) Capture for Biogas Upgrading

Aperçu de la solution

Specially engineered activated carbon with tuned pore structures selectively adsorbs CO₂ from biogas streams. Deployed in pressure swing adsorption systems for methane enrichment.
